From e04be3731f4921cd51d25b1d6210eace7600fea4 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?L=C5=91rinc?= Date: Tue, 7 Jan 2025 15:49:19 +0100 Subject: [PATCH] init,log: Unify block index and chainstate loading log line Example logs before the change: ``` 2025-01-07T11:58:33Z Verification progress: 99% 2025-01-07T11:58:33Z Verification: No coin database inconsistencies in last 6 blocks (18905 transactions) 2025-01-07T11:58:33Z block index 31892ms 2025-01-07T11:58:33Z Setting NODE_NETWORK on non-prune mode 2025-01-07T11:58:33Z block tree size = 878086 2025-01-07T11:58:33Z nBestHeight = 878085 ``` Removed redundant duration as well since it can be recovered from the timestamps. Co-authored-by: TheCharlatan Co-authored-by: MarcoFalke <*~=`'#}+{/-|&$^_@721217.xyz> --- src/init.cpp |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/src/init.cpp b/src/init.cpp index b5adcf64760..cb4ff733a50 100644 --- a/src/init.cpp +++ b/src/init.cpp @@ -1245,7 +1245,6 @@ static ChainstateLoadResult InitAndLoadChainstate( "", CClientUIInterface::MSG_ERROR); }; uiInterface.InitMessage(_("Loading block index…").translated); - const auto load_block_index_start_time{SteadyClock::now()}; auto catch_exceptions = [](auto&& f) { try { return f(); @@ -1263,7 +1262,7 @@ static ChainstateLoadResult InitAndLoadChainstate( } std::tie(status, error) = catch_exceptions([&] { return VerifyLoadedChainstate(chainman, options); }); if (status == node::ChainstateLoadStatus::SUCCESS) { - LogPrintf(" block index %15dms\n", Ticks(SteadyClock::now() - load_block_index_start_time)); + LogInfo("Block index and chainstate loaded"); } } return {status, error};